What Is a Carriage Bolt?


A carriage bolt is a type of bolt with a round, dome-shaped head and a square section directly beneath the head. The square neck fits into the material during installation and prevents the bolt from turning while the nut is tightened.


This unique design allows installation from one side using only a wrench on the nut, making carriage bolts easy and convenient to use.



Materials Used for Carriage Bolts


Carriage bolts are manufactured using different materials to suit various applications, including:




  • Carbon Steel

  • Stainless Steel

  • Alloy Steel

  • Brass

  • Zinc-Plated Steel


Stainless steel carriage bolts are commonly used in outdoor and marine environments because they offer excellent resistance to rust and corrosion.



Types of Carriage Bolts


1. Standard Carriage Bolts


These are the most commonly used carriage bolts. They feature a round head and square neck and are suitable for general-purpose fastening.



2. Stainless Steel Carriage Bolts


These bolts provide excellent corrosion resistance and are ideal for outdoor, coastal, and wet environments.



3. Galvanized Carriage Bolts


Galvanized carriage bolts have a protective zinc coating that helps prevent rust and extends service life.



4. Metric Carriage Bolts


These bolts are manufactured according to metric dimensions and are widely used in international projects and machinery.



Advantages of Carriage Bolts


Smooth and Safe Surface


The rounded head creates a clean appearance and eliminates sharp edges, reducing the risk of injury.



Easy Installation


The square neck prevents rotation, allowing easy tightening of the nut without holding the bolt head.



Strong Fastening


Carriage bolts provide secure connections and can handle heavy loads in many applications.



Corrosion Resistance


When made from stainless steel or coated with protective finishes, carriage bolts can resist rust and weather damage.



Attractive Appearance


The smooth dome-shaped head provides a neat and professional finish, making these bolts ideal for visible installations.



Applications of Carriage Bolts


Wood Construction


Carriage bolts are widely used for joining wooden beams, decks, fences, and outdoor structures.



Furniture Manufacturing


Many furniture products use carriage bolts because of their attractive appearance and secure fastening.



Agricultural Equipment


Farm machinery and agricultural structures often use carriage bolts due to their strength and reliability.



Machinery and Equipment


Carriage bolts help assemble machinery, industrial equipment, and mechanical structures.



Playground and Outdoor Structures


These bolts are commonly used in playground equipment, benches, and outdoor installations where safety is important.
